8b3639cb78 dccp/tcp: Call security_inet_conn_request() after setting IPv6 addresses.
[ Upstream commit 23be1e0e2a83a8543214d2599a31d9a2185a796b ]

Initially, commit 4237c75c0a35 ("[MLSXFRM]: Auto-labeling of child
sockets") introduced security_inet_conn_request() in some functions
where reqsk is allocated.  The hook is added just after the allocation,
so reqsk's IPv6 remote address was not initialised then.

However, SELinux/Smack started to read it in netlbl_req_setattr()
after commit e1adea927080 ("calipso: Allow request sockets to be
relabelled by the lsm.").

Commit 284904aa7946 ("lsm: Relocate the IPv4 security_inet_conn_request()
hooks") fixed that kind of issue only in TCPv4 because IPv6 labeling was
not supported at that time.  Finally, the same issue was introduced again
in IPv6.

Let's apply the same fix on DCCPv6 and TCPv6.

9a3f9054a5 llc: verify mac len before reading mac header
[ Upstream commit 7b3ba18703a63f6fd487183b9262b08e5632da1b ]

LLC reads the mac header with eth_hdr without verifying that the skb
has an Ethernet header.

Syzbot was able to enter llc_rcv on a tun device. Tun can insert
packets without mac len and with user configurable skb->protocol
(passing a tun_pi header when not configuring IFF_NO_PI).

    BUG: KMSAN: uninit-value in llc_station_ac_send_test_r net/llc/llc_station.c:81 [inline]
    BUG: KMSAN: uninit-value in llc_station_rcv+0x6fb/0x1290 net/llc/llc_station.c:111
    llc_station_ac_send_test_r net/llc/llc_station.c:81 [inline]
    llc_station_rcv+0x6fb/0x1290 net/llc/llc_station.c:111
    llc_rcv+0xc5d/0x14a0 net/llc/llc_input.c:218
    __netif_receive_skb_one_core net/core/dev.c:5523 [inline]
    __netif_receive_skb+0x1a6/0x5a0 net/core/dev.c:5637
    netif_receive_skb_internal net/core/dev.c:5723 [inline]
    netif_receive_skb+0x58/0x660 net/core/dev.c:5782
    tun_rx_batched+0x3ee/0x980 drivers/net/tun.c:1555
    tun_get_user+0x54c5/0x69c0 drivers/net/tun.c:2002

Add a mac_len test before all three eth_hdr(skb) calls under net/llc.

There are further uses in include/net/llc_pdu.h. All these are
protected by a test skb->protocol == ETH_P_802_2. Which does not
protect against this tun scenario.

But the mac_len test added in this patch in llc_fixup_skb will
indirectly protect those too. That is called from llc_rcv before any
other LLC code.

It is tempting to just add a blanket mac_len check in llc_rcv, but
not sure whether that could break valid LLC paths that do not assume
an Ethernet header. 802.2 LLC may be used on top of non-802.3
protocols in principle. The below referenced commit shows that used
to, on top of Token Ring.

At least one of the three eth_hdr uses goes back to before the start
of git history. But the one that syzbot exercises is introduced in
this commit. That commit is old enough (2008), that effectively all
stable kernels should receive this.

fed492aa64 usb: dwc2: fix possible NULL pointer dereference caused by driver concurrency
[ Upstream commit ef307bc6ef04e8c1ea843231db58e3afaafa9fa6 ]

In _dwc2_hcd_urb_enqueue(), "urb->hcpriv = NULL" is executed without
holding the lock "hsotg->lock". In _dwc2_hcd_urb_dequeue():

    spin_lock_irqsave(&hsotg->lock, flags);
    ...
	if (!urb->hcpriv) {
		dev_dbg(hsotg->dev, "## urb->hcpriv is NULL ##\n");
		goto out;
	}
    rc = dwc2_hcd_urb_dequeue(hsotg, urb->hcpriv); // Use urb->hcpriv
    ...
out:
    spin_unlock_irqrestore(&hsotg->lock, flags);

When _dwc2_hcd_urb_enqueue() and _dwc2_hcd_urb_dequeue() are
concurrently executed, the NULL check of "urb->hcpriv" can be executed
before "urb->hcpriv = NULL". After urb->hcpriv is NULL, it can be used
in the function call to dwc2_hcd_urb_dequeue(), which can cause a NULL
pointer dereference.

This possible bug is found by an experimental static analysis tool
developed by myself. This tool analyzes the locking APIs to extract
function pairs that can be concurrently executed, and then analyzes the
instructions in the paired functions to identify possible concurrency
bugs including data races and atomicity violations. The above possible
bug is reported, when my tool analyzes the source code of Linux 6.5.

To fix this possible bug, "urb->hcpriv = NULL" should be executed with
holding the lock "hsotg->lock". After using this patch, my tool never
reports the possible bug, with the kernelconfiguration allyesconfig for
x86_64. Because I have no associated hardware, I cannot test the patch
in runtime testing, and just verify it according to the code logic.

62af7d4d70 leds: pwm: Don't disable the PWM when the LED should be off
[ Upstream commit 76fe464c8e64e71b2e4af11edeef0e5d85eeb6aa ]

Disabling a PWM (i.e. calling pwm_apply_state with .enabled = false)
gives no guarantees what the PWM output does. It might freeze where it
currently is, or go in a High-Z state or drive the active or inactive
state, it might even continue to toggle.

To ensure that the LED gets really disabled, don't disable the PWM even
when .duty_cycle is zero.

This fixes disabling a leds-pwm LED on i.MX28. The PWM on this SoC is
one of those that freezes its output on disable, so if you disable an
LED that is full on, it stays on. If you disable a LED with half
brightness it goes off in 50% of the cases and full on in the other 50%.

7b0e690456 ARM: 9321/1: memset: cast the constant byte to unsigned char
[ Upstream commit c0e824661f443b8cab3897006c1bbc69fd0e7bc4 ]

memset() description in ISO/IEC 9899:1999 (and elsewhere) says:

	The memset function copies the value of c (converted to an
	unsigned char) into each of the first n characters of the
	object pointed to by s.

The kernel's arm32 memset does not cast c to unsigned char. This results
in the following code to produce erroneous output:

	char a[128];
	memset(a, -128, sizeof(a));

This is because gcc will generally emit the following code before
it calls memset() :

	mov   r0, r7
	mvn   r1,         ; 0x7f
	bl    00000000 <memset>

r1 ends up with 0xffffff80 before being used by memset() and the
'a' array will have -128 once in every four bytes while the other
bytes will be set incorrectly to -1 like this (printing the first
8 bytes) :

	test_module: -128 -1 -1 -1
	test_module: -1 -1 -1 -128

The change here is to 'and' r1 with 255 before it is used.

56e8949825 sched/rt: Provide migrate_disable/enable() inlines
[ Upstream commit 66630058e56b26b3a9cf2625e250a8c592dd0207 ]

Code which solely needs to prevent migration of a task uses
preempt_disable()/enable() pairs. This is the only reliable way to do so
as setting the task affinity to a single CPU can be undone by a
setaffinity operation from a different task/process.

RT provides a seperate migrate_disable/enable() mechanism which does not
disable preemption to achieve the semantic requirements of a (almost) fully
preemptible kernel.

As it is unclear from looking at a given code path whether the intention is
to disable preemption or migration, introduce migrate_disable/enable()
inline functions which can be used to annotate code which merely needs to
disable migration. Map them to preempt_disable/enable() for now. The RT
substitution will be provided later.

Code which is annotated that way documents that it has no requirement to
protect against reentrancy of a preempting task. Either this is not
required at all or the call sites are already serialized by other means.

793e4c1c6b hwrng: geode - fix accessing registers
[ Upstream commit 464bd8ec2f06707f3773676a1bd2c64832a3c805 ]

When the membase and pci_dev pointer were moved to a new struct in priv,
the actual membase users were left untouched, and they started reading
out arbitrary memory behind the struct instead of registers. This
unfortunately turned the RNG into a constant number generator, depending
on the content of what was at that offset.

To fix this, update geode_rng_data_{read,present}() to also get the
membase via amd_geode_priv, and properly read from the right addresses
again.

cf098e937d platform/x86: wmi: Fix opening of char device
[ Upstream commit eba9ac7abab91c8f6d351460239108bef5e7a0b6 ]

Since commit fa1f68db6ca7 ("drivers: misc: pass miscdevice pointer via
file private data"), the miscdevice stores a pointer to itself inside
filp->private_data, which means that private_data will not be NULL when
wmi_char_open() is called. This might cause memory corruption should
wmi_char_open() be unable to find its driver, something which can
happen when the associated WMI device is deleted in wmi_free_devices().

Fix the problem by using the miscdevice pointer to retrieve the WMI
device data associated with a char device using container_of(). This
also avoids wmi_char_open() picking a wrong WMI device bound to a
driver with the same name as the original driver.
